BIOL 4950 - Directed StudyCOURSE DESCRIPTION. Prerequisite: completion of all required upper-division biology courses with distinctly superior academic records and the consent of the instructor. Limited to selected students with approval of instructor and Department Head. A specific problem to include supervised investigation and a report in format of biological journals. NOTE: Prospective students are advised that successful completion of the Directed Study project will require a minimum of 3 hours of intensive work per week for each credit hour. Students are encouraged to present results of their Directed Study projects at the Annual Undergraduate Research Symposium sponsored by the Council for Undergraduate Research. Registration for Directed Study is handled directly by the Department Head. Students interested in Directed Study should consult with their instructor and the Department Head well in advance of registration.
